    Sonic the Hedgehog Time Attacked was an amazing game at its release. After the release of the controversial swan song of classic clickteam, Sonic: the Fast Revelation, it seemed that Jamie Bailey had released ANOTHER classic game for us to play that was actually fun.

    This is a resurrection of that game.

    I have been talking to Jamie Bailey(and taliking a little bit to Blazehedgehog discussing how to contact Jamie.) about this, and he gave me the big OK to start working on a remake for the 20th Anniversary of Sonic the Hedgehog, as well as the 8th anniversary of the fangame's release. Being a remake, I don't expect to make it as good as the original, but I hope to make this as close as I can to the original, being made in Game Maker rather than MMF.

    Now, in these discussions with Jamie, I was told about some unfavorable things that he would have changed in game, one of those being the act long ship and drill machine gimmicks. I understand that talking about this would cause some fans of the original game to panic, for fear that I will absolutely destroy this remake and make the original look bad because of this. This is (partially) not true. As I have said before, while I cannot emulate the game perfectly, I will try to make it as close as I can while eliminating bugs and adding things that were meant to be in the original.

    A list of things that will be changed are provided here:

    1. The gimmick levels

    Yes, I am shortening the gimmick levels so that they do not take up one full act, taking up a small part of the act instead.


    2. Past Sonic's levels SPOILER ALERT WARNING

    Bailey said that I could tweak some stuff in the game. To me(and to some other people I'm SURE OF THIS.), the past version was way too short, only taking up one zone before the diabolical plot unfolds and Sonic is offed in the past. I have extended this past time zone to three zones rather than just one, explaining how Robotnik found Tails, and adding more length to the game as a whole. The new levels will include a dense forest and a scrap brain zone-esque base with traps galore.

    3. Other Monitors
    Again, while discussing with Bailey, I was told that one addition that would be a good idea is the addition of other power up monitors.
    The original had Ring and 1-up monitors. This remake will add in Shield, Speed Shoe, and Invincibility monitors. Don't let the fact that I'm using an engine fool you with this, I've added in some great effects that allow the invincibility and shields to be as accurate as possible to the ones found on Megadrive titles.

    4. The possibility of a Special Stage and Super Sonic
    Yes, I MIGHT add that in as a bonus, but don't get your hopes up, I'm still debating on whether to add this feature in. I have tested it, and Super Sonic does work with a cycling palette, speed and invincibility, the ability to jump high, and the ability to do moves normal Sonic cannot (Such as a jump dash, and a ring dash move.)

    5. Bonus content
    I will be replacing almost all of the bonus content due to multiple reasons.(Specifically, the SAGE level because it's outdated and needs to be updated for the new SAGE; the Evolution levels, as I didn't work on the game from those levels first like Bailey did; and the Christmas levels are being replaced with new christmas levels, as well as other holiday themed events that react to the date on your computer!) I'm keeping in Marathon mode and the Beginning level, as well as an updated SAGE level.
